Why freight insurance and risk cover matters on the Elite Lite
Cover should start at the factory gate rather than at the port of loading.
Documentation is not paperwork for its own sake; on freight insurance and risk cover it is the difference between a clean clearance and a delayed one.
Declared value needs to match the commercial invoice or claims are reduced proportionally.

Frequently asked questions
Is freight insurance worth it for Elite Lite orders?
For container level orders it is; the premium is small relative to the exposure from loss, theft or water damage.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
